测试

package xyz.tcst.struts2.ognl;

import org.junit.Test;

import ognl.Ognl;
import ognl.OgnlContext;
import ognl.OgnlException;

/**
 * OGNL在java环境下的使用
 * @author Administrator
 *
 */
public class OgnlDemo1 {

	@Test
	/*
	 * OGNL调用对象的方法:
	 */
	public void demo1() throws OgnlException {
		//获得context
		OgnlContext context = new OgnlContext();
		//获得根对象
		Object root = context.getRoot();
		//执行表达式:		
		Object obj = Ognl.getValue("'helloworld'.length()", context, root);
		System.out.println(obj);
	}
}

  

posted @ 2020-01-06 11:07  叫我木木大人  阅读(83)  评论(0)    收藏  举报